DC 600 FEATURES
Controls: All of the controls for the flash heads are included on the generator itself.
Outlets: The generator has 2 outlets, allowing either 1 or 2 flash heads to be fitted to it. If 1 flash head is fitted, the maximum power is 600 Ws, which is enough to overpower the sun in most lighting situations. If 2 flash heads are fitted, up to 400Ws of power is delivered to socket A and the other 200Ws is delivered to socket B.
Power adjustment: Flash output is adjustable from full power down to 1/16th, via a click stop adjustment dial. Because twice as much power (400 Ws) is available from socket A than from socket B (200 Ws) the power from socket B can be reduced to just 12.5 Ws, a total adjustment range of 6.3 stops!
Setting the power: The power is set via a click-stop dial, and the setting is shown on the LED display.
Modelling lamp: The modelling lamp can also be switched on or off manually if required. The cool-running LED modelling lamp is the brightest in its class, with a 44% higher output than its brightest rival. , The LED display shows the length of time that you have set for the modelling lamp to be on (up to 99 seconds).
Battery: Although the lithium battery is lightweight and tiny, it has an enormous capacity and provides 360 flashes at full power (many more at lower power settings). It makes no difference whether one or two flash heads are fitted.
Consistency: The flash performance is amazing ? the flash energy consistency varies no more than 1/10th of a stop at any power setting, and the colour temperature is extremely consistent too, varying flash to flash by no more than 10K (10 degrees on the Kelvin scale)! The colour temperature is 5600 at full power and reduces by only 340K at minimum power.
Recycling time: The recycling time is extremely fast, there are two settings, normal and fast. Using the normal setting drains the battery less quickly, so this setting should be used when possible. At normal recycling setting, it recycles in just one second at minimum power and 3.75 seconds at full power. When you switch to fast recycling those times become an incredible 0.384 seconds at minimum power and 2.9 seconds at full power.
Flash duration: The STROBEPRO DC 600has a short flash duration of 1/1400th sec at full powr and 1/900th sec at minimum power. This is fast enough for all normal portrait/fashion/glamour usage.
Performance: At 100 ISO and with the standard reflector fitted
At full power the guide number is 166 (ft) or 54.45(m)
At 400 Ws the guide number is119 (ft) or 39.03 (m)
And at minimum power the guide number is 23 (ft) or 7.54 (m) ? a massive 6.3 stops of total adjustment.
Outlet sockets: Two lamp sockets with an asymmetric 1:2 power ratio.

How does it compare with other makes?
The DC 600 generator unit is slightly larger and heavier than the Elinchrom Ranger Quadra but produces 5 times more flashes per charge at any given power setting, so you are unlikely to need to take a spare battery with you to location shoots, making it much smaller, lighter and cheaper than the Quadra. The flash head is also slightly larger and heavier than the Quadra head, but the Quadra head becomes larger (and more expensive) when the adapter needed for accessories is fitted to it.
